对象存储的好处,对象存储的数据安全,架构优势、潜在风险与系统化防护策略
- 综合资讯
- 2025-04-19 04:48:08
- 3

对象存储通过分布式架构实现海量数据的高效存储与弹性扩展,具备低成本、高可用性和多协议接入等核心优势,其数据安全机制涵盖端到端加密(静态数据加密+传输加密)、细粒度权限控...
对象存储通过分布式架构实现海量数据的高效存储与弹性扩展,具备低成本、高可用性和多协议接入等核心优势,其数据安全机制涵盖端到端加密(静态数据加密+传输加密)、细粒度权限控制(RBAC+多因素认证)及多副本容灾体系,支持合规审计与数据溯源,潜在风险包括API接口泄露、DDoS攻击及冷数据丢失,需构建动态防护体系:部署零信任访问控制(ZTA)、建立威胁情报驱动的异常检测系统、实施自动化数据备份与版本管理,同时采用硬件安全模块(HSM)强化加密组件,通过持续渗透测试与红蓝对抗提升系统韧性,形成覆盖全生命周期的安全防护闭环。
对象存储的崛起与安全需求
在数字化转型浪潮中,对象存储(Object Storage)凭借其高扩展性、低成本和易管理特性,已成为企业数据存储的核心基础设施,根据Gartner 2023年报告,全球对象存储市场规模预计在2025年达到680亿美元,年复合增长率达19.3%,伴随而来的数据泄露事件(如2022年AWS S3存储桶权限错误导致1.2亿条数据泄露)也引发了对数据安全的深度担忧,本文将深入剖析对象存储的安全机制,揭示其架构设计的天然优势,同时系统梳理当前面临的主要威胁,并提出涵盖技术、管理和合规的立体化防护体系。
第一章 对象存储的安全架构设计
1 分布式存储的天然防御机制
对象存储通过分布式架构实现数据冗余存储,其核心设计遵循"3-2-1"原则:数据副本至少存储在3个物理节点,采用2种不同的存储介质,并保留1份离线备份,这种设计使得单个节点故障不会导致数据丢失,同时通过跨机房部署(如AWS的跨可用区复制)抵御区域级灾难。
技术实现细节:
- 分片存储(Sharding):将对象拆分为固定大小的数据块(通常128KB-256KB),每个分片独立分配存储位置
- 纠删码(Erasure Coding):采用RS-6/10等算法,允许在丢失1-2个分片的情况下恢复完整数据
- 版本控制:自动保留历史版本(如MinIO支持无限版本回溯),防止误删操作
2 多层级权限控制系统
对象存储通过细粒度权限管理实现数据隔离,其权限模型可分为四个维度:
图片来源于网络,如有侵权联系删除
管理层级 | 实现方式 | 典型应用场景 |
---|---|---|
账户级 | IAM(身份访问管理) | 用户权限分配 |
策略级 | RBAC/ABAC | 动态权限控制 |
对象级 | 签名/加密令牌 | 单文件访问控制 |
存储级 | 策略引擎 | 自动分类分级 |
以阿里云OSS为例,其权限体系支持:
- 继承式权限:通过存储桶策略向下级对象自动继承权限
- 临时令牌(Token):基于JWT的访问凭证,有效期可精确到秒
- MFA多因素认证:强制要求密码+短信验证码双重认证
3 端到端加密技术栈
对象存储的加密体系包含三个关键环节:
存储加密(At Rest)
- 全盘加密:使用AES-256-GCM算法对存储卷进行加密(如Ceph的CRUSH算法)
- 对象级加密:支持SSE-S3(AWS)、SSE-KMS(Azure)等模式,实现细粒度加密
- 密钥管理:集成HSM硬件模块(如AWS KMS)或云原生加密服务(如HashiCorp Vault)
传输加密(In Transit)
- TLS 1.3强制使用:所有API请求默认启用TLS 1.3协议
- 国密算法支持:部分云服务商提供SM4/SM9国密算法(如华为云)
- 隧道加密:通过VPN或专用网关(如Cloudflare Workers)构建安全通道
访问加密(In Use)
- 内存加密:采用AES-NI指令集实现内存数据加密(如MinIO的内存加密模式)
- 动态脱敏:在对象访问时实时解密敏感数据(如金融数据脱敏处理)
4 自动化安全运维体系
对象存储平台内置多项自动化安全功能:
- 漏洞扫描:定期检测存储桶策略漏洞(如开放读权限)
- 行为分析:基于机器学习识别异常访问模式(如AWS S3异常检测)
- 合规审计:自动生成符合GDPR/CCPA的访问日志(如Azure Monitor)
- 灾难恢复:RTO(恢复时间目标)<15分钟,RPO(恢复点目标)<1秒
第二章 对象存储面临的主要安全挑战
1 权限配置错误导致的暴露风险
根据Verizon《2023数据泄露调查报告》,72%的数据泄露源于配置错误,典型场景包括:
- 公开存储桶:未设置访问控制列表(ACL),导致对象暴露在公网
- 策略冲突:继承策略与对象级策略矛盾(如存储桶公开但对象私有)
- 临时令牌泄露:开发环境凭证误置到代码仓库(如GitHub Actions泄露AWS密钥)
典型案例分析: 2022年某电商平台因存储桶策略配置错误,导致1.2亿用户隐私数据(身份证号、支付信息)被公开访问,事件直接导致公司市值蒸发8.7亿美元。
2 API接口的安全威胁
对象存储的RESTful API成为攻击者重点目标,主要攻击向量包括:
- SSRF(服务器-side request forgery):通过API请求内嵌攻击URL获取内部信息
- 暴力破解:针对弱密码的存储桶访问尝试(如AWS S3弱密码攻击事件)
- DDoS攻击:利用对象存储的批量上传功能发起资源耗尽攻击
攻击技术演进:
- 供应链攻击:通过污染SDK库植入恶意代码(如2021年Log4j漏洞)
- AI辅助攻击:利用生成对抗网络(GAN)伪造合法访问请求
3 数据生命周期管理难题
对象存储的"无限存储"特性带来新的管理挑战:
- 数据分类失序:未建立自动标签体系,导致合规审查耗时增加300%
- 冷热数据混淆:未实施分层存储策略,造成存储成本浪费(如AWS S3标准存储误存低频数据)
- 元数据泄露:通过对象元数据(如创建时间、修改记录)推断敏感信息
4 合规性要求升级
全球数据监管框架加速演进,对对象存储提出新要求:
- GDPR第32条:要求加密密钥存储在受控环境中(如欧盟禁止云服务商提供加密服务)
- 中国《数据安全法》:规定重要数据本地化存储(如金融数据需存储在境内)
- 跨境传输限制:美国CLOUD法案与欧盟《数据治理法案》的管辖权冲突
第三章 系统化防护解决方案
1 三层防御体系构建
第一层:基础设施防护
- 硬件级防护:采用TPM 2.0芯片实现固件级加密
- 网络隔离:部署VPC网络隔离(AWS)、Security Group(Azure)
- 物理安全:机柜生物识别门禁(如Equinix的Access 2.0)
第二层:数据保护机制
- 动态脱敏:在对象访问时实时替换敏感字段(如正则表达式过滤)
- 水印技术:嵌入不可见数字水印(如AWS S3对象水印)
- 差分隐私:在聚合数据时添加噪声(如人口统计数据的统计混淆)
第三层:智能运维体系
- 威胁情报平台:集成MITRE ATT&CK框架进行攻击模拟
- 自动化响应:通过SOAR平台实现漏洞修复(如AWS Systems Manager自动化修复)
- 持续验证:季度性渗透测试(如使用Metasploit进行API接口测试)
2 密钥管理最佳实践
构建"五不"密钥管理体系:
图片来源于网络,如有侵权联系删除
- 不存储:密钥始终保存在HSM(如Luna HSM)或KMS服务中
- 不共享:采用动态密钥分配(如AWS KMS的临时密钥)
- 不泄露:通过Just-In-Time访问控制限制密钥使用范围
- 不丢失:多因素备份(如3副本+异地冷存储)
- 不失效:定期轮换密钥(符合NIST SP 800-171要求)
典型方案:
- 混合云场景:使用HashiCorp Vault管理跨云密钥
- 区块链存证:将密钥哈希值上链(如AWS与蚂蚁链合作方案)
- 零信任架构:每次访问需重新验证密钥有效性
3 合规性自动化工具链
开发覆盖全生命周期的合规工具:
- 策略审计工具:定期扫描存储桶策略(如AWS S3 Audit Manager)
- 分类标签系统:基于AI模型自动打标签(如Azure Information Protection)
- 跨境传输合规检查:自动检测数据流向(如阿里云数据合规引擎)
- 审计报告生成:一键导出符合ISO 27001/等保2.0的审计报告
技术实现:
- 知识图谱构建:将法规条款映射到存储桶属性(如GDPR的"被遗忘权"对应对象删除)
- 模拟攻击测试:使用OpenVAS扫描对象存储漏洞
- 持续合规监控:基于Prometheus+Grafana搭建合规仪表盘
4 新兴技术融合应用
量子安全加密准备
- 后量子密码研究:在AWS实验室测试CRYSTALS-Kyber lattice-based算法
- 量子随机数生成:用于生成抗量子攻击的密钥(如IBM Quantum Key Distribution)
AI驱动的威胁检测
- 异常行为识别:训练LSTM神经网络分析访问模式(准确率>98%)
- 自动化取证:通过对象元数据重建攻击链(如访问时间戳+IP地址关联)
区块链存证应用
- 数据完整性证明:使用Merkle Tree生成哈希链(如AWS与Hyperledger合作)
- 审计追溯:在对象创建时自动上链(如腾讯云区块链存储服务)
第四章 典型行业应用案例
1 金融行业:风险控制体系
某头部银行部署对象存储安全架构:
- 加密策略:客户数据全量AES-256加密,交易记录使用SM4国密算法
- 访问控制:基于OpenID Connect实现RBAC权限管理
- 审计追踪:每秒生成10万条操作日志,保留周期180天
- 成本优化:通过S3 Intelligent-Tiering将冷数据自动迁移至归档存储
安全成效:
- 数据泄露风险降低92%
- 合规审计时间从2周缩短至2小时
- 存储成本年节省3800万元
2 医疗行业:隐私保护实践
某三甲医院构建医疗影像安全体系:
- 对象生命周期管理:采用"创建-检查-归档-销毁"四阶段策略
- 患者隐私保护:在DICOM文件中嵌入区块链存证(使用Hyperledger Fabric)
- 分级加密:电子病历(EMR)使用AES-256,影像文件(DICOM)使用3D-PUF抗克隆加密
- 访问追溯:通过X.509证书实现多级权限控制(医生/技师/管理员)
技术亮点:
- 开发专用DICOM加密插件,兼容PACS系统
- 部署GPU加速的加密模块,处理速度提升40倍
- 建立符合HIPAA的加密审计数据库(EDB)
3 制造业:工业物联网安全
某汽车厂商部署工业数据平台:
- 边缘-云协同:使用AWS IoT Core实现设备数据加密传输
- 数据脱敏:在边缘节点实时过滤振动传感器数据中的IP地址
- 异常检测:通过Kafka Streams构建时序数据分析模型
- 数字孪生集成:将加密对象与CAD模型关联(使用AWS Outposts)
安全指标:
- 设备数据泄露率降至0.003%
- 工业控制系统(ICS)攻击防御成功率100%
- 数据存储成本降低65%(通过S3 Glacier Deep Archive)
第五章 未来发展趋势
1 技术演进方向
- 自修复存储架构:基于联邦学习自动修复数据损坏(如Google的RAID-4改进方案)
- 神经拟态存储:利用忆阻器实现低功耗加密(如IBM TrueNorth芯片)
- 空间加密技术:在存储介质物理层面实现加密(如Optane持久内存加密)
2 行业监管变化
- 数据主权立法:欧盟《数字市场法案》要求云服务商提供数据本地化证明
- 碳足迹认证:ISO 14064标准将存储能效纳入合规要求
- 供应链安全:美国BIS新规限制对华技术出口(如加密算法源代码审查)
3 用户行为演变
- 开发者安全意识提升:GitHub调查显示,78%的开发者使用SAST/DAST工具检测存储桶漏洞
- 安全即服务(SECaaS):云服务商提供对象存储安全托管服务(如Azure Security Center)
- 零信任存储模型:每次访问均需动态验证(如BeyondCorp架构扩展)
构建动态平衡的安全体系
对象存储的安全防护绝非静态过程,而是需要持续演进的系统工程,企业应建立"预防-检测-响应-恢复"的闭环机制,将安全能力融入存储架构设计阶段,随着量子计算、AI大模型等技术的突破,对象存储安全将面临新的挑战,但同时也迎来零信任、自愈系统等创新解决方案,唯有保持技术敏锐度,构建弹性安全体系,才能在数字化转型中筑牢数据防线。
(全文共计4128字,基于公开资料重构并补充原创技术分析)
本文链接:https://www.zhitaoyun.cn/2150443.html
发表评论